Transaction e22c7f91c76f2527c871f0b878686fcedf6212dacb06ee01f4a71bddfa4720d7

1 Input
2 Outputs
  • e22c7f91c76f2527c871f0b878686fcedf6212dacb06ee01f4a71bddfa4720d7:0
  • value  70187054
    address  17oxnpnLtEufKvKNrg4KpzZgQYY8Xcr3nq
  • e22c7f91c76f2527c871f0b878686fcedf6212dacb06ee01f4a71bddfa4720d7:1
  • value  1684948
    address  15ck9npscuXCDt4pXFa49gdToiTVncuAJL